Address

RhhmhHGq7SH4jPUjz51ZV3EwQqVSr89wRu

0 RDD

Confirmed
Total Received44262.55000000 RDD1.67 USD
Total Sent44262.55000000 RDD1.67 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RhhmhHGq7SH4jPUjz51ZV3EwQqVSr89wRu44262.55000000 RDD0.40 USD1.67 USD
 
RssALiHnomGwA4ZsWEoLz3cRReUjFfGMxD123.00000000 RDD0.00 USD0.00 USD
Rig5asHniYs9WpHbSj52YF1wZU6X2SJF8944139.45000000 RDD0.40 USD1.67 USD
RiZkHuPipYBcjq5k696W6mjbT3CqkrGnxv44447.65000000 RDD0.40 USD1.68 USD
 
RhhmhHGq7SH4jPUjz51ZV3EwQqVSr89wRu44262.55000000 RDD0.40 USD1.67 USD
RgFTuZieMAWT814DimcY4seCcxEWHhPusi185.00000000 RDD0.00 USD0.01 USD